Welcome to "Upgrade Your Life", a transformative podcast hosted by Dexter and Dr. Tanya, also known as the Upgraders. In this episode, the duo focusses on the common yet overlooked habit of people-pleasing and shares 10 signs to help you identify it in your own behavior. The Upgraders emphasize the importance of prioritizing your own goals, needs, and desires, underlining how often people compromise them in the name of pleasing others.
Throughout the episode, the hosts draw upon their experiences both in their personal lives and in their career paths, sharing valuable insights from various fields including leadership and communication, emotional intelligence, and mindset development. They elaborate on the implications of suppressing your desires and needs, with specific attention on how this behavior might stifle individual growth and fulfillment.
Further, they delve into the habit of avoiding conflicts and how it can often lead to unresolved issues, long-term stress, and strained relationships. The realization and acceptance of the existence of conflict, balanced with effective communication, is highlighted as a step towards healthier interpersonal dynamics and self-improvement.
Aimed at sparking a realization within the listeners about their own patterns, the goal of this episode is to encourage listeners to step out of their comfort zone and confront their people-pleasing behaviors. Join Dexter and Dr. Tanya as they emphatically exclaim, "Get out of your own way - there's so much more on the other side of you!".

Welcome to another illuminating episode of "The Upgrade" with Dexter and Dr. Tanya, where we tackle personal development issues often overlooked in the seductive rush to upgrade material possessions. In this episode, we delve deep into the universal yet challenging issue of "people-pleasing", a puzzle that approximately 49% of adults grapple with, according to a recent 2022 YouGov poll. Our goal? To light up the warning signs of people-pleasing and its potential implications, equipping you to break free from its self-imposed limitations.
Our spirited discussion revolves around our free e-book "10 Signs You Are a People-Pleaser". We explore signifiers of this draining behaviour pattern, such as the difficulty in saying "no", a prime culprit leading to burnout. The journey to transformation begins with understanding, and by comprehending why you resort to people-pleasing, we aim to guide you in dismantling these barriers to personal growth and advancement.
Let us demystify people-pleasing for you - a pervasive issue that surreptitiously hampers personal and professional growth. Join us as we delineate the hazards of people-pleasing, laying emphasis on the pressing need to establish healthy boundaries. Drawing from our personal experiences, we stress that people-pleasing isn't an alien concept; rather, overindulgence in making others happy at the stake of one's wellbeing has damaging outcomes.
Marking the cornerstone of our conversation, we as "recovering" people-pleasers, lay bare strategies to identify and tackle people-pleasing tendencies. Learn how personal development, self-awareness and a healthy dose of mindfulness can aid in combating this behaviour. Discover the importance of focusing on your needs and standing strong with a firm 'no' when required.
In highlighting certain behaviours such as needless apologies, we help you understand how this undermines your self-worth and credibility. Awareness and a proper understanding of these patterns hold the key to improving personal, professional, and social interactions. In a nutshell, this episode aims to guide you on your self-improvement journey, promoting healthy boundaries, enhancing self-worth, and helping you break free from the chains of people-pleasing.
